Michael Mansfield

description Michael Mansfield Overview

Michael Mansfield is a British barrister who specializes in human rights and civil liberties cases. He was called to the Bar in 1967 and became a Queen's Counsel (now King's Counsel) in 1989. Throughout his career, he has frequently represented individuals and families in high-profile, contentious cases, such as the families of the Hillsborough disaster victims and the Stephen Lawrence inquiry. He is known for his dedication to challenging state authority and advocating for investigative justice.

help Michael Mansfield FAQ

Which Hillsborough families did Michael Mansfield represent?

Mansfield acted for families of victims during the legal proceedings surrounding the 1989 Hillsborough disaster. The later inquests concluded in April 2016 that the 96 people then recognized as victims had been unlawfully killed.

What role did Michael Mansfield have in the Stephen Lawrence case?

He represented Stephen Lawrence's family in their private prosecution and during the public inquiry. Lawrence was murdered in southeast London in 1993, and the resulting Macpherson Inquiry became a landmark examination of institutional racism.

Which miscarriage-of-justice cases made Michael Mansfield prominent?

His career included work connected with the Birmingham Six, Guildford Four, Cardiff Five, and Barry George. These cases helped establish his reputation as a barrister willing to challenge disputed convictions.

Did Michael Mansfield also work on Bloody Sunday and the Princess Diana inquest?

Yes. He represented Bloody Sunday families and Mohamed al-Fayed during the inquest into the deaths of Diana, Princess of Wales, and Dodi Fayed.
